Tied And United

San Francisco.

In December, 1934, Edna Edwards. publle relations counsel for the deaf, served us a "sign interpreter" for thei marriage of Esther and Arthur R. Gage. Almost to the day, four years later, she served in the same capacity for their divorce.

LATE NEWS

Pitiful Scenes At Hospitals

Pluiful scenes were witnessed this; afternoon at the Kowloon Hospital as the stream of wounded civilians were brought in from the border by umbulances.

The most pitiful eases were those of old and young women, their limbs shattered and their clothes blood- stained. During the early rush, two or three student doctors were called in to cope with the influx of cases. Operations are being performed on three wounded civilians, it is under- stood.

Owing to lack of accommodation only serious cases are being admitted other to Kowloon Hospital, The cases are being sent to the Kwong Wah and Lalchikok hospitals as soon is they receive first uld.

Most of the casualties so far re- celved at Kowloon Hospital sustain- ed their wounds from bullets, con- firming the fact that the Japanese extensively machine-gunned populace as well as bombing clly.

Woman Dies With NOVAC DUO

Bullet Wounds

An unknown Chinese woman who was wounded during the border rald died in Kowloon Hospital shortly

after admission,

In addition to sustaining a frac-i tured leg, the woman was the victim of machine-gunning, at least two bullets lodging in her stomach.
